Kamila Solarz is a photographer rooted in quiet observation and a deep sensitivity to space and presence. Based between Barcelona and Warsaw, her practice moves between analog and digital formats, with a focus on capturing the subtle interplay between people, spaces, and objects. With a refined sense of composition and a sensitivity to light, Kamila creates images that feel both intentional and instinctive.
Her work is defined by its tranquil precision — minimal, tactile, and emotionally resonant. Each image invites stillness and attention. The images speak in subtleties: soft light, meaningful silences, matter in its most delicate form. There is clarity in her framing, but always room for what unfolds naturally. Nature, architecture, art and the human presence coexist in a quiet dialogue, where every element has its space.
Kamila collaborates with creative projects, brands, artists, and designers, always seeking to understand the essence behind what she photographs. She approaches each project with care and clarity, crafting narratives that are timeless, elegant, and deeply human. She captures what surrounds her subjects — the feeling, the stillness, the in-between.

Everything starts with the process — the space where ideas begin to take shape. Through gestures, materials, and time. the creator brings the object to life, leaving a trace of their own presence within it. 
From the process, the object is born. It carries the memory of its making — textures, forms, and quiet details that speak of care, thought, and instinct. 
The object then finds its place in space. Space gives context to the object. Light, architecture, and atmosphere respond to its presence, allowing the object to be seen, to be experienced. 
One gives life to the other: the artist gives life to the object, the space gives life to the object’s presence. Each phase depends on the next, forming a continuous cycle. 
My intention is to observe and photograph each stage with care — capturing the flow from creation to presence, from material to experience — leaving a trace of what often remains invisible: the silent dialogue between process, object, space, and the presence that connects them.
